'AC/DC: No Bull' Back on Track for Blu-ray
Mon Oct 19, 2009 at 06:00 PM ETTags: Disc Announcements, Sony Music (all tags)
After a delay of over a year, the legendary band's 1996 concert filmed in Madrid, Spain will finally hit Blu-ray in two months.
Sony music is prepping 'AC/DC: No Bull' for a high-definition release on December 8.
There's no word on tech specs or extras as of yet, but a full track listing can be viewed here.
Suggested list price for the Blu-ray has been set at $24.98.
